I am happy to inform you that the Dept of Zoology, Ganpat Parsekar
College of Education - Harmal, Goa, has released the second issue of its
Email newsletter "* Animalis*”.
This issue of "*Animalis*" endeavors to maintain a theme on “World Turtle
Day” along with other columns of interest.
In this issue, we have the following –
· From the editor board – *The drifting DNA and the Turtle*
· Expert opinion – *Turtle trail, tale*. Dr. Manoj R Borkar (Carmel
college for women).
· Q. And the Answer- *Questions related to Molecular biology** answered
by* Dr. Avelyno D’ Costa (Goa University).
· Alumni trail – *Indigenous tree, Tradition, Culture* by Pankaj
Moraskar
· Guest Corner – *A hairy Evidence* by Dr. Saroj Babar (National
Forensic Science University – Goa Center).
· Open Forum – *Riddle of the Olive Ridley* by Mohit Mudliar ( M.Sc
Wildlife Science – WII Dehradun).
· Vision Board – *Taste mein best, Mummies and Everest* by Giselle
Henriques
